1 banana
1 handful of blueberries
1 handful of kale
1 handful of spinach
1 tsp almond butter
1 tsp honey
Blended together until smooooooth!

3 handfuls of spinach
125ml water
1 apple, cored and chopped
1 handful frozen mango
1 handful of green grapes
2 tsp ground flaxseeds
Blend until smooooooth!

2 handfuls spinach
1 handful of kale
200ml water (I used coconut)
1 banana
1 apple cored and diced
1 handful frozen strawberries
1 tsp ground flaxseeds
Blend. Wah-lah.

1 handful of mixed greens
2 handfuls of spinach
150 ml water
handful of fresh or frozen blueberries
1 banana, peeled
1 apple, cored and chopped
2 tsp. ground flaxseeds
And smoothie it …

1 cup of coconut water
2 handfuls of spinach or chopped kale
1 quarter of a chopped pineapple
1 ripe banana, chopped
BLEND.
